Balsamic beef in clay pot

What do you need:

  • 1 3/4 kilograms of boneless round roast beef
  • 4 garlic cloves, minced
  • 1 cup of beef broth
  • 1/4 cup balsamic vinegar
  • 2 tablespoons soy sauce
  • 1 tablespoon of honey
  • 1/2 teaspoon red pepper flakes
  • Kosher salt
  • Black pepper

Combine garlic, beef broth, balsamic vinegar, soy sauce, honey, and red pepper flakes in medium bowl. Rub the roast beef with kosher salt and ground black pepper, then place in a slow cooker. For a balsamic mixture throughout the meat. Cover and cook for 8 hours over low heat. When done, shred meat in crock pot using 2 large forks. Serve over mashed potatoes, cooked rice, or as sandwiches.

Slow-cooked chicken and cheese taquitos

What do you need:

  • 8 pieces of 8-inch whole wheat tortillas
  • 2 large chicken breasts
  • 3/4 cup chicken broth
  • 1/2 cup cheddar cheese shredded
  • 1/4 cup cream cheese
  • 1/4 cup sauce
  • 1 packet all-natural taco seasoning mix

Rub the taco seasoning over the chicken breasts and then place the meat in a crock pot. For chicken broth especially chicken. Cover and cook 4 to 5 hours over low heat. When done, shred the chicken. Add the cream cheese and sauce to the pot and stir to coat the chicken. Spread the tortillas out on a flat surface and distribute the chicken mixture to each. Top each with grated cheese. Roll up the tortillas and place on a baking sheet seam side down. Bake in a preheated oven (400F) until the tortillas are golden brown and the cheese has melted, about 10 to 15 minutes.

Delicious clay pot thyme ribs

What do you need:

  • 1 3/4 kilograms of beef ribs
  • 2 pieces of fresh thyme
  • 2 1/2 cups onion, chopped
  • 1 cup of red wine
  • 2/3 cup tomato sauce
  • 3 tablespoons soy sauce
  • 2 tablespoons brown sugar
  • 2 tablespoons Worcestershire sauce
  • 1 tablespoon of olive oil
  • 2 teaspoons minced garlic

Heat the olive oil in a skillet over medium-high heat and then cook the ribs until golden brown on all sides. Remove from the pan and replace with onion and garlic. Cook until tender. Place the cooked meat, onion, and garlic in a slow cooker. Combine the red wine, tomato sauce, soy sauce, brown sugar, and Worcestershire sauce in a bowl and pour over the meat in the slow cooker. Place the thyme on top of the meat. Cover and cook 7 to 8 hours over low heat.
